Sharp pains down the back of the leg can be a number of things; Sciatic nerve pinch, peripheral artery disease like Atherosclerosis (hardening of the arteries), abnormality in a disk or the spinal canal—a tumor, an infection, or the bone itself - Osteomyelitis.
With a 20 year history of diabetes, complications may arise which may or can lead to amputation. Go see a doctor asap and get to the root cause of your pain before its to late. Also, try posting on the Ask the Doctor forum - see the link below from the Med Help post on 10/03

There is a medication called Lyrica that can help nerve pain. You have to start taking it gradually, and increase dosage slowly. Doctors will usually start you out with samples to see if it will help you. It can cause you to gain weight tho. I had to stop taking it because of that, as I need to lose weight not gain it.
